The Maltese national broadcaster, PBS, has tonight released the names of the 49 entries shortlisted for the upcoming Maltese national selection, Malta Eurovision Song Contest (MESC).
Back in October, MESC 2016 submissions opened where artists and composers were able to submit their entries for the Maltese national selection. Submissions were received from the 29 to the 30 October and over the following weeks since, a total of 49 acts have been shortlisted.

A number of returning MESC acts have made the shortlist for the 2016 Maltese national selection, including some of last year’s Maltese finalists such as Christabelle, Franklin, Daniel Testa, Laurence Grey, Jessika and Deborah C. Also making the shortlist is Malta’s 2002 representative Ira Losco who, with her entry 7th wonder, finished in 2nd position in the host city of Tallinn, bringing Malta their joint-best results to date.
A total of 153 submissions were received for MESC 2016, 19 more than the previous year. The entries have since been decreased to 49 entries and will once again be narrowed down to a final total of 20. The final 20 acts will be revealed next week.
MESC 2016 will be made up of 2 live shows; a semi-final (phase 1) and a grand final (phase 2). The 20 selected acts will compete in the semi-final where a judging panel made up of 6 members as well as a televote will decide which 14 acts will move forward to the grand final of the selection. The MESC 2016 selection will take place at the end of January at the Mediterranean Conference Centre.
MESC 2016 dates
- 22/01: Semi-final (20 semi-finalists, 14 qualifiers)
- 23/01: Grand final
